Vanadiumhexarbonyl is a metal carbonyl having the chemical formula V (CO ) 6 These highly reactive species is noteworthy from a theoretical and scientific perspective. It is a rare example of an isolable homoleptic metal carbonyl, which is paramagnetic. Most metal carbonyls with the formula Mex (CO ) y follow the 18- electron rule, while V (CO) 6 has only 17 valence electrons.

Properties

Physical Properties

Vanadiumhexacarbonyl is a solid at room temperature, a crystalline substance of a bluish - green color. It does not dissolve in water or ethanol, little in saturated hydrocarbons such as hexane but good in other organic solvents with yellow coloration of the solution. The wavenumber of the CO stretching vibration of the free νCO carbon monoxide is at 1976 cm -1.

V ( CO) 6 has an octahedral coordination geometry ( Oh). High-resolution X-ray crystallography shows that the molecule is slightly distorted with two shorter V -C bonds of 199.3 pm and four equatorial of 200.5 pm. Such a distortion could have arisen due to the Jahn- Teller effect.

Chemical Properties

V (CO) 6 reacts with the cyclopentadienyl anion to an orange complex ( C5H5) V (CO ) 4 ( melting point 136 ° C). How many charge-neutral organometallic compounds is this half -sandwich complex volatile.

V (CO) 6 is a thermally sensitive material. Its primary reaction is the reduction to the monoanion [V (CO ) 6] - and the substitution by phosphines, often with disproportionation. Vanadiumhexacarbonyl can release toxic compounds such as carbon monoxide and vanadium oxides in the decomposition. The substance is a pyrophoric compound, which may explode when heated.

Use

Vanadiumhexacarbonyl is used as a catalyst in isomerization and hydrogenation reactions.
